A vulnerability described as problematic has been identified in Cayman DSL Router. This issue affects some unknown processing of the component ICMP Packet Handler. Executing a manipulation can lead to denial of service. This vulnerability is registered as CVE-2000-0418. Furthermore, an exploit is available. The application of restrictive firewalling is recommended.

A vulnerability classified as critical was found in Cayman DSL Router (Router Operating System) (unknown version). This vulnerability affects an unknown code block of the component ICMP Packet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. As an impact it is known to affect availability. CVE summarizes:

The Cayman 3220-H DSL router all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service via oversized ICMP echo (ping) requests.

The weakness was published 05/23/2000 (Website). The advisory is shared for download at archives.neohapsis.com. This vulnerability was named CVE-2000-0418. The exploitation appears to be easy. The attack can be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is required for a successful exploitation. Technical details are unknown but a public exploit is available.

After immediately, there has been an exploit disclosed. It is possible to download the exploit at exploit-db.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ept.

Proper firewalling of is able to address this issue.
